Jing Zhao commented on HDFS-8805:
---------------------------------
Thanks for updating the patch, [~brahmareddy]! The new patch removes the
{{includeStoragePolicy}} parameter from both {{getFileInfo}} methods. Actually
we still need the parameter for the first one: {{getFileInfo(FSDirectory,
String, INodesInPath, boolean, boolean)}}, considering it is called by
{{getAuditFileInfo}} which does not require the storage policy information. We
only need to remove the parameter from the other getFileInfo:
{{getFileInfo(FSDirectory, String, boolean, boolean, boolean)}}.

> The result of getStoragePolicy command is always 'unspecified' even we has
> set a StoragePolicy on a directory.But the real placement of blocks is
> correct.
> The result of fsck is not correct either.
> {code}
> $ hdfs storagepolicies -setStoragePolicy -path /tmp/cold -policy COLD
> Set storage policy COLD on /tmp/cold
> $ hdfs storagepolicies -getStoragePolicy -path /tmp/cold
> The storage policy of /tmp/cold is unspecified
> $ hdfs fsck -storagepolicies /tmp/cold
> Blocks NOT satisfying the specified storage policy:
> Storage Policy Specified Storage Policy # of blocks
> % of blocks
> ARCHIVE:4(COLD) HOT 5
> 55.5556%
> ARCHIVE:3(COLD) HOT 4
> 44.4444%
> {code}
